The Verdict
AdRoll is built for ecommerce and dtc brands, with a focus on retargeting and display-ads. Klaviyo targets ecommerce and shopify stores and leads with email-campaigns and sms-marketing.
On pricing, Klaviyo is the clear winner for budget-conscious users — starting at $20/mo compared to $36/mo for AdRoll. That $16/mo difference adds up quickly for growing teams.
Klaviyo has a free plan, which gives it a meaningful edge for individuals and small teams exploring their options. AdRoll requires a paid subscription from day one.
Klaviyo edges out on user ratings (4.5 vs 4). While both are well-regarded, that gap reflects real differences in user satisfaction worth considering.
Both tools are a solid fit for ecommerce, dtc brands, shopify stores — in those cases, the decision often comes down to workflow style and how your team prefers to organize work.
Bottom line: Klaviyo has a slight overall edge — but if great retargeting matters most to you, AdRoll may still be the right call.
